Katie N.

I came to Takoda to meet up with a friend for Happy Hour. The location is great! There is a metro, buses, and a parking lot across the bar, which always works great for friends coming from various locations after work. [[HIGHLIGHT]]The seating was first come first serve, and we had no issues getting a table.[[ENDHIGHLIGHT]] We ordered our drinks and food at the bar and you are given a number so your items can be delivered to your table. Everything came out in a timely fashion. The menu is limited and sticks to your bar food items (think tater tots, chicken wings). [[HIGHLIGHT]]If you're expecting a big dinner I would say come here for pre-dinner drinks, but if you are looking for a casual spot to hang out with friends on a summer evening this spot should be in your rotation.[[ENDHIGHLIGHT]]

Elizabeth A.

Location Across street from Nationals stadium. Parking We walked/ metro'd-parking for fee in this area Service Rose was fantastic-friendly, fast, informative about the menu and area. Atmosphere Casual and relaxed vibe-has an upstairs that the bartender welcomed us! Both areas have large tv's-sports. Rooftop has great view of the yard. Food and beverage Mule-outside anding-fresh ginger House sparkling-AMAZING House red-sparking, dry, I was not a fan but my husband liked it. Fish n chips-see picture-3 battered lightly fish pieces that were moist and delish. Two sauces accompanied and were both so yummy I got them to go! My husband said it was the best. Comes with cole slaw and fries that we substituted with a salad that was much larger than expected. Summary What a great find! Casual bar with optional roof top-outstanding service, food and drinks! Happy hour til 6. Can't wait to return soon.
